package com.javarush.task.task04.task0428;
/*
Положительное число
*/
import java.io.*;
import java.util.*;
public class Solution {
public static void main(String[] args) throws Exception {
//напишите тут ваш код
Scanner s = new Scanner(System.in);
int[] arr = new int[3];
int i = 0, count = 0;
while (s.hasNextInt())
{
arr[i] = s.nextInt();
if (arr[i] > 0)
count += 1;
i++;
}
System.out.println(count);
}
}
Anonymous #2075099
26 уровень
Запускает, работает, все выводит - но автопроверка пишет: "Отсутствует вывод". Не понимай(
Решен
Комментарии (5)
- популярные
- новые
- старые
Для того, чтобы оставить комментарий Вы должны авторизоваться
Александр Дорофеев Backend Developer в Ай-Теко Expert
25 апреля 2019, 07:09
Надо посмотреть номер задачи и набрать его в поле при создании вопроса.
0
Александр Дорофеев Backend Developer в Ай-Теко Expert
25 апреля 2019, 07:08
Прикрепи саму задачу.
Судя по первому скрину, ты считываешь только 1 цифру, что то мне кажется, это не так должно работать.
0
Anonymous #2075099
25 апреля 2019, 07:21
Поправил
0
Александр Дорофеев Backend Developer в Ай-Теко Expert
25 апреля 2019, 07:34
1
2
3
4
Exception in thread "main" java.lang.ArrayIndexOutOfBoundsException: 3
at Solution.main(Solution.java:17)
Process finished with exit code 1
0
Anonymous #2075099
25 апреля 2019, 07:46
Убрал массив и хэш, все заработало. Магия...
0